인공지능(AI) 개발자가 되는 법과 관련 기술 배우기

인공지능(AI) 개발자가 되는 법과 관련 기술 배우기

인공지능(AI) 개발자는 현대 기술 분야에서 매우 중요한 역할을 맡고 있으며, 그 수요는 날로 증가하고 있습니다. 이 글에서는 인공지능 개발자가 되는 방법, 필요한 기술, 그리고 이 직업의 매력에 대해 자세히 알아보겠습니다.

인공지능 개발자가 하는 일

AI 개발자는 기계가 인간의 지능을 모방하도록 하는 프로그램 및 시스템을 설계하고 구현하는 전문가입니다. 이들은 다양한 응용 프로그램에서 인공지능을 활용하고, 데이터 분석 및 알고리즘 설계 등의 업무를 수행합니다. 주요 업무는 다음과 같습니다:

  • 인공지능 모델 설계 및 개발: 효과적인 알고리즘을 통해 데이터를 분석하고 예측하는 모델을 구축합니다.
  • 데이터 전처리 및 관리: 대량의 데이터를 수집하고 이를 정제하여 분석 가능하도록 가공합니다.
  • 프로젝트 기획 및 실행: 고객의 요구사항에 맞춘 AI 솔루션을 개발하고, 이를 통해 실질적인 비즈니스 문제를 해결합니다.
  • 알고리즘 성능 평가: 개발한 모델의 성능을 테스트하고, 필요에 따라 개선합니다.

인공지능 개발자가 되기 위한 단계

AI 분야에 진입하기 위해서는 몇 가지 단계를 거쳐야 합니다. 다음은 인공지능 개발자가 되기 위한 전반적인 과정입니다:

1. 기초 지식 습득

인공지능 분야의 기초가 되는 프로그래밍 언어와 이론을 익히는 것이 중요합니다. 주로 사용하는 언어는 Python이며, Java나 C++도 자주 사용됩니다. 기본적으로 알고리즘과 자료구조에 대한 이해는 필수입니다. 이러한 기초 지식은 인공지능 개발의 초석이 됩니다.

2. 관련 학위 취득

최소한 컴퓨터 공학, 데이터 과학, 통계학 등 관련 분야에서 학사, 석사 또는 박사 학위를 취득하는 것이 좋습니다. 이 과정에서 다양한 알고리즘 및 이론을 심도 있게 학습할 수 있습니다.

3. 실습 경험 쌓기

이론적인 지식만으로는 실제 문제를 해결하기 어렵습니다. 따라서 다양한 프로젝트를 통해 실습 경험을 쌓아야 합니다. 개인 프로젝트를 진행하거나, 오픈 소스 프로젝트에 참여하는 것도 좋은 방법입니다.

4. 전문 기술 습득

AI 개발자는 데이터 분석, 머신러닝, 딥러닝 프레임워크(TensorFlow, PyTorch 등)에 대한 이해가 필요합니다. 이를 통해 고급 알고리즘을 구현하고 데이터를 효율적으로 처리할 수 있습니다.

필요한 기술 및 도구

인공지능 개발에 필요한 주요 기술을 정리해보겠습니다:

  • 프로그래밍 언어: Python, Java, C++
  • 데이터 분석 도구: NumPy, Pandas, Scikit-learn
  • 머신러닝 프레임워크: TensorFlow, Keras, PyTorch
  • 데이터 시각화 도구: Matplotlib, Seaborn

이 외에도 머신러닝 및 딥러닝의 기초를 이해하고, 알고리즘 및 특정 도메인에 맞춘 문제 해결 능력을 기르는 것이 중요합니다.

커리어 발전과 연봉

AI 개발자는 경력에 따라 높은 연봉을 받을 수 있는 직업 중 하나입니다. 초봉은 보통 3천만 원에서 시작하며, 숙련된 전문가의 경우 연봉이 1억 원을 넘을 수 있습니다. 또한, 다양한 산업에서 AI 기술을 적용하려는 수요가 증가하고 있어 장기적으로 안정적인 직업이 될 가능성이 높습니다.

결론

인공지능 개발자가 되는 여정은 쉽지 않지만, 매우 보람 있는 과정입니다. 지속적인 학습과 경험이 중요한 만큼, 관심을 가지고 이 분야에 도전해 보시기 바랍니다. AI 개발자로서의 길은 무한한 가능성과 다양한 기회를 제공할 것입니다.

자주 묻는 질문 FAQ

인공지능 개발자가 되기 위해 어떤 기초 지식이 필요한가요?

AI 개발자가 되기 위해서는 프로그래밍 언어, 특히 Python에 대한 이해가 중요합니다. 또한, 알고리즘과 자료구조와 같은 기초 개념을 확실히 익히는 것이 필요합니다.

인공지능 분야에 진입하기 위해 학위가 꼭 필요한가요?

전문성을 높이기 위해 컴퓨터 공학이나 데이터 과학과 같은 관련 분야에서 학위를 취득하는 것이 권장됩니다. 하지만 실무 경험도 매우 중요하므로 학위 없이도 도전할 수 있습니다.

AI 개발자로서의 커리어 전망은 어떤가요?

인공지능 분야는 계속해서 성장하고 있으며, 이에 따라 관련 직군에 대한 수요도 증가하고 있습니다. 경력이 쌓일수록 높은 연봉과 다양한 기회를 기대할 수 있습니다.

답글 남기기

이메일 주소는 공개되지 않습니다. 필수 필드는 *로 표시됩니다